Why deployment readiness matters in professional services ERP programs
Professional services firms rarely fail in ERP implementation because the platform lacks features. They fail because resource planning, project execution, time capture, revenue recognition, billing operations, and reporting governance remain fragmented across teams. Deployment readiness is therefore an enterprise transformation discipline, not a pre-go-live checklist. It determines whether the organization can move from disconnected delivery operations to a governed operating model that supports utilization, margin control, forecast accuracy, and client billing confidence.
In consulting, IT services, engineering, legal, and agency environments, the ERP system becomes the operational backbone connecting sales commitments, staffing decisions, project delivery, subcontractor costs, milestone billing, and financial close. If those workflows are not standardized before rollout, the implementation inherits legacy ambiguity. The result is usually delayed deployment, invoice disputes, weak adoption, inconsistent project reporting, and executive distrust in the new system.

The core alignment problem: resource, project, and billing operate on different clocks
Most professional services organizations manage three interdependent engines that evolved separately. Resource management focuses on capacity, skills, bench, and utilization. Project operations focus on scope, milestones, delivery status, and change orders. Billing and finance focus on contract terms, rate cards, revenue schedules, invoice timing, and collections. When these engines are not synchronized, the ERP deployment exposes structural misalignment rather than solving it.
A common example is a global consulting firm that staffs projects in one tool, tracks time in another, manages project financials in spreadsheets, and bills from a finance platform with limited project context. During ERP rollout, leadership expects a unified view of margin by project and consultant. Instead, the program discovers inconsistent role definitions, duplicate project codes, local billing exceptions, and no common policy for approved time versus billable time. The implementation challenge is therefore governance and harmonization, not interface mapping alone.
| Operational domain | Typical legacy gap | Deployment risk | Readiness priority |
|---|---|---|---|
| Resource planning | Skills and availability managed locally | Low staffing accuracy and poor utilization reporting | Standardize roles, calendars, and capacity rules |
| Project delivery | Inconsistent stage gates and project coding | Weak forecast reliability and status ambiguity | Define common project lifecycle and controls |
| Billing operations | Contract terms interpreted differently by region | Invoice disputes and revenue leakage | Harmonize billing rules and approval workflows |
| Financial reporting | Manual reconciliation across systems | Delayed close and low trust in margin data | Establish master data and reporting ownership |
What ERP deployment readiness should include before design is finalized
Readiness should be assessed across operating model, data, governance, technology, and adoption. Many firms move too quickly into solution design workshops without first deciding which resource planning policies are global, which project controls are mandatory, and which billing exceptions are still strategically justified. This creates design churn, scope expansion, and late-stage executive escalations.
- Operating model readiness: common definitions for project types, roles, utilization logic, rate structures, approval thresholds, and delivery stage gates
- Data readiness: clean client, project, contract, employee, vendor, rate card, and work breakdown data with clear stewardship
- Governance readiness: decision rights for PMO, finance, delivery leadership, HR, and regional operations during design, testing, and rollout
- Technology readiness: integration strategy for CRM, PSA, HCM, payroll, procurement, and analytics in a cloud ERP modernization context
- Adoption readiness: role-based onboarding, manager enablement, training pathways, and support models tied to operational scenarios
For professional services firms, readiness also requires policy clarity around hybrid delivery models. Organizations using employees, contractors, offshore teams, and alliance partners need explicit rules for staffing visibility, cost attribution, timesheet approvals, and client billing treatment. Without those controls, the ERP platform cannot produce reliable project economics.
Cloud ERP migration raises the governance bar
Cloud ERP migration is often positioned as a technology upgrade, but in professional services it is more accurately a governance reset. Cloud platforms enforce more standardized process patterns, release cycles, security models, and reporting structures. That can be beneficial, but only if the organization is prepared to retire local workarounds and redesign exception-heavy workflows.
Consider a multinational engineering services company moving from regionally customized on-premise systems to a cloud ERP with integrated project accounting. The migration team may technically map contracts, projects, and billing schedules into the new platform. Yet if local offices still maintain separate staffing spreadsheets and manually override milestone billing logic, the cloud ERP becomes a system of record without becoming a system of execution. Readiness means deciding which local practices will be absorbed, which will be redesigned, and which require controlled extensions.
This is where cloud migration governance matters. Executive sponsors should require a formal exception review process, architecture guardrails for customizations, and a phased deployment methodology that protects operational continuity. The objective is not to replicate every legacy behavior in the cloud. It is to create a scalable operating model with enough standardization to support growth, acquisitions, and cross-border delivery.
Workflow standardization is the foundation of billing confidence
Billing problems in professional services are usually symptoms of upstream workflow inconsistency. If project setup is delayed, time entry is incomplete, change requests are not approved, or rate cards are not governed, invoice quality deteriorates. ERP deployment readiness should therefore focus on end-to-end workflow standardization from opportunity handoff through project closure.
A practical target state includes standardized project initiation, controlled assignment of billable resources, governed time and expense capture, automated validation of contract terms, and transparent billing approvals. This reduces write-offs, accelerates invoicing, and improves client trust. It also gives leadership a more reliable view of backlog, earned revenue, and delivery margin.
| Workflow stage | Required control | Business outcome |
|---|---|---|
| Opportunity to project handoff | Approved scope, rate card, and billing model transfer | Cleaner project setup and fewer contract disputes |
| Resource assignment | Role and cost alignment with approved project plan | Better utilization and margin predictability |
| Time and expense capture | Policy-based validation and manager approval | Higher billing accuracy and faster revenue processing |
| Invoice generation | Automated checks against milestones, caps, and terms | Reduced leakage and improved collections |
Implementation governance for professional services ERP rollout
Governance in these programs must go beyond status reporting. It should actively manage process decisions, data ownership, deployment sequencing, and adoption risk. A strong model typically includes an executive steering committee, a transformation PMO, a design authority, and workstream leads spanning finance, delivery operations, resource management, HR, and IT.
The design authority is especially important. Professional services firms often face recurring debates about local billing practices, project hierarchy structures, utilization formulas, and approval thresholds. Without a formal body to adjudicate these issues against enterprise principles, the program accumulates exceptions that undermine scalability. Governance should also include implementation observability: milestone health, defect trends, training completion, data quality scores, and adoption indicators by business unit.
- Set enterprise design principles early, including standard project lifecycle, billing policy hierarchy, and master data ownership
- Use deployment waves based on operational complexity, not only geography or business size
- Track readiness metrics such as clean project master data, approved rate cards, trained managers, and tested billing scenarios
- Require cutover and continuity plans for payroll, invoicing, revenue recognition, and client reporting
- Establish post-go-live stabilization governance with issue triage, adoption analytics, and process compliance reviews
Organizational adoption is an operating model issue, not a training event
Professional services users experience ERP differently depending on role. Consultants need fast time entry and staffing visibility. Project managers need forecast, budget, and margin controls. Finance teams need billing integrity and revenue accuracy. Practice leaders need utilization and pipeline insight. If onboarding is generic, adoption will be uneven and workarounds will return quickly.
An effective adoption strategy uses role-based enablement tied to real operating scenarios: assigning a consultant to a fixed-fee project, approving subcontractor costs, managing a change order, or releasing a milestone invoice. Managers should be trained not only on transactions but on the control logic behind them. This is critical in cloud ERP modernization, where standardized workflows often replace informal local practices.

Operational resilience and continuity during deployment
Professional services firms cannot afford disruption to time capture, payroll inputs, client invoicing, or project reporting during ERP transition. Operational resilience should therefore be built into the deployment methodology. This includes cutover rehearsals, fallback procedures for critical transactions, invoice contingency planning, and clear ownership for issue escalation during stabilization.
A realistic scenario is a firm going live at quarter end while several large milestone invoices are due. If billing validation rules are not fully tested, revenue timing and cash flow can be affected immediately. Readiness planning should identify these high-risk periods and either avoid them or create protective controls. The same applies to resource assignment cycles, payroll deadlines, and client reporting commitments.
Executive recommendations for deployment readiness
Executives should treat professional services ERP deployment as a business model alignment program. The highest-value decisions are usually not technical. They involve standardizing project governance, clarifying billing policy ownership, reducing local exceptions, and aligning incentives so delivery leaders, finance, and resource managers operate from the same data and control framework.
A practical executive agenda includes four priorities: define the target operating model before detailed design, govern cloud migration choices through enterprise architecture and PMO controls, invest in role-based adoption and manager accountability, and measure success through operational outcomes such as invoice cycle time, utilization visibility, forecast accuracy, and margin transparency. When these disciplines are in place, the ERP platform becomes an engine for connected enterprise operations rather than another fragmented system.
For firms pursuing growth, acquisition integration, or global delivery expansion, deployment readiness is also a scalability decision. Standardized resource, project, and billing processes make it easier to onboard new business units, compare performance across practices, and absorb future change without rebuilding the operating model each time. That is the real modernization value of a well-governed ERP implementation.
